EOS Aircraft is dedicated to revolutionizing regional aviation with innovative aircraft solutions. With offices in the U. S. and Canada, the company focuses on developing advanced aircraft technologies to enhance regional air travel, promoting efficiency, safety, and sustainability in the aerospace sector.
β’ Responsible for developing the initial concept, design, integration, and certification of the fuel and inerting system. β’ Work closely with engineering teams, suppliers, and regulatory agencies to deliver a reliable and efficient integrated system that meets certification requirements. β’ Create Technical Requirements Document (TRD) for required systems/components. β’ Carry out trade studies to align with aircraft configuration(s). β’ Support Fault Hazard and System Safety Analysis for associated systems.
β’ Bachelorβs degree in Aerospace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or related field. β’ Minimum of 10 years in the aerospace industry within an aircraft or OEM environment. β’ In-depth knowledge of fuel system design, system integration, and aerospace CFR Part 25 certification processes. β’ Prior experience in fuel system and component sizing analysis. β’ Prior experience in component qualification and creation of certification documentation. β’ Exceptional problem-solving skills and the ability to address technical challenges through innovative solutions. β’ Outstanding communication and interpersonal skills, capable of effectively collaborating with internal teams, suppliers, and regulatory bodies.
